When stored in an airtight container, such as a Mylar bag, cornmeal can last for up to 18 months. That said, it's important to keep the cornmeal dry, as moisture can cause mold to grow. No. Cornbread made with cornmeal, but the two aren't the same thing. To achieve a golden loaf of cornbread, it takes more than just cornmeal. There also has to be correct proportions of flour, salt, baking powder, and baking soda, and wet ingredients such as eggs and buttermilk somewhere in the mix to make it rise and become nice and tender.

Freeze Flat: If using freezer bags, squeeze out any excess air and lay them flat in the freezer. This allows for quicker freezing and easier stacking and organization. Store at Freezer Temperature: Set your freezer temperature to 0°F (-18°C) or below to maintain the quality of the cornmeal.

Shelf Life: Indefinitely. The best way to store cornmeal is in the freezer. It will last indefinitely this way. However, be cautious when removing cornmeal from the freezer: moisture will start to form in the bag. The pockets of moisture can cause the cornmeal to get moldy very quickly.

In fact, as a science instructor and writer, I sift old bags of cornmeal and look for the different stages of insect metamorphosis. The mummy looking pupae stage is actually very cool looking! To prevent the growth and reproduction of critters in meals, store them in the freezer or refrigerator. This is where I keep my flour and cornmeal.

Bags might also be labeled "stone-ground cornmeal. " Stone-grinding—which is, um, just what it sounds like—means that some of the hull and germ of the kernel are retained.
